Wheelchair users often face challenges when it comes to accessing outdoor spaces. Pavements, gravel, grass, sand, and uneven terrain can create obstacles that make movement difficult or even impossible. Most traditional wheelchairs are built for flat, predictable surfaces, which means many outdoor activities remain out of reach. Comfort is another key factor. Standard wheelchairs can struggle with bumps and uneven surfaces, leading to discomfort and fatigue. Trekinetic wheelchairs are built with a lightweight carbon fibre monocoque seat that provides better support, reducing strain on the body and making long journeys more manageable. The suspension system helps absorb shocks from rough ground, ensuring a smoother ride.

For those who love outdoor activities, an all-terrain wheelchair provides even greater benefits. Trekinetic’s manual and powered models allow users to take on hills, muddy paths, and even snow. The GTE power-assisted model offers additional support, allowing users to switch between manual control and motor power when needed. This flexibility ensures that no terrain is out of reach.
